A 30 degree central angle is in central position in a circle with a radius of 7 square roots of 5 (245). What are the coordinates of the point where the terminal ray intersects the cicrle?

construct a right angled triangle
and call the point at the circle (x,y)
then sin30 = y/7√5
y = (1/2)(7√5) = 7√5/2
cos30 = x/7√5
x = (√3/2)(7√5) = 7√15/2
